Why Most Teams Get AI Agents Wrong Before They Start

The most common failure mode in Monday.com AI adoption is not technical. It is conceptual. Teams approach AI agents the way they approach automation recipes, as something you configure after the process is already designed. The board is built. The workflow is established. Then someone adds an AI agent on top of it and wonders why the outputs are inconsistent, the recommendations feel generic, or the agent keeps surfacing the wrong items.

The root cause is structural. AI agents are not a feature layer. They are a reasoning layer, and the quality of their reasoning is entirely determined by the quality and structure of the data they can access. According to Gartner, only 13% of organizations believe they currently have the right governance structures in place for AI agents, highlighting how many businesses are deploying AI systems without the operational foundation needed to support them.

Monday.com’s AI agent architecture operates through a continuous cycle: observe what is happening across boards and connected systems, analyze that context against business rules and historical patterns, determine the appropriate action, execute it, monitor the result, and refine. That cycle is powerful when the underlying data is structured, consistent, and contextually rich. When boards have inconsistent naming conventions, incomplete ownership fields, missing status labels, or no defined priority hierarchy, the agent’s observation layer sees noise instead of signal, and everything downstream from that observation degrades accordingly.

Certified Monday.com experts understand this before they build anything. The configuration decisions that make AI agents reliable (data architecture, status taxonomies, ownership models, and cross-board dependency mapping) look invisible once they are in place. They are the difference between an agent that surfaces genuine insight and one that produces confident approximations.

The Architecture Underneath monday.com AI Agents

Understanding the architecture is a strategic concern because the architectural choices made during Monday.com implementation determine the ceiling of everything an AI agent can do inside the platform.

Seven components work together to make Monday.com AI agents function. Environmental awareness is the layer that continuously monitors activity across boards, status transitions, form submissions, linked integrations, and connected applications, transforming raw board data into structured inputs that the agent can reason about. Decision-making intelligence, powered by large language models, sits on top of that observation layer and determines what response to generate based on what the agent has observed.

Strategic planning enables agents to decompose a complex directive, “prepare the quarterly PMO review,” into a sequenced set of executable actions: retrieve project board data, assess milestone completion, identify overdue dependencies, calculate capacity utilization, structure findings into a summary, and distribute it to defined stakeholders. Without this planning component, agents can only respond to individual requests. With it, they can orchestrate multi-step processes autonomously.

Contextual memory is what separates agents that behave like persistent organizational collaborators from those that treat every interaction as a fresh start. Session memory maintains context through a single workflow execution. Persistent memory allows agents to recall past decisions, reference established preferences, and build on previous outputs across separate sessions. For Monday.com PMO Solutions environments managing ongoing programs across quarters, this distinction is operationally significant.

Platform connectivity is the action layer, the capability that allows agents to create items, update statuses, send notifications, trigger integrations, and write back to connected systems rather than simply generating text. An agent without connectivity can advise. An agent with connectivity can act. Workflow coordination manages the sequencing and exception handling across multi-step executions, ensuring that when one step fails, the agent does not silently abandon the downstream chain.

Finally, dynamic knowledge access through retrieval-augmented generation allows agents to pull from organizational knowledge repositories, past project documentation, company-specific processes, product knowledge, and historical data when formulating responses. This is what makes the difference between an agent that gives generally correct answers and one that gives contextually appropriate ones for your specific organization.

Certified Monday.com experts configure all seven of these layers deliberately during implementation, not as an afterthought once the boards are live. Four Agent Patterns and What They Mean for Real Teams


Monday.com’s AI agent architecture supports four distinct operational patterns. Understanding which pattern fits which workflow is one of the most practically valuable things a Monday.com expert brings to an engagement, because applying the wrong pattern to a workflow produces an agent that technically functions but does not genuinely help.

  • Iterative reasoning agents work through exploration. They evaluate available information, take a step, examine the result, and determine the next action based on what they have discovered. This pattern is right for research-intensive workflows: vendor evaluation, risk identification, and project status investigation across multiple boards. The agent does not know the full answer before it starts. It builds toward it through progressive discovery.
  • Sequential execution agents separate planning from implementation. The agent designs the full action sequence upfront and then executes each step systematically. This is the right pattern for standardized, repeatable processes, client onboarding in Monday.com workflow solutions, sprint setup in Monday Dev, compliance documentation workflows, or new hire coordination. Consistency is the value here. Every execution follows the same path, eliminating the variability that creeps into manual process execution.
  • Distributed collaboration systems deploy multiple specialized agents that work concurrently on different workflow components, with a coordinating agent synthesizing their outputs. For PMO teams managing complex programs with financial, resource, delivery, and stakeholder dimensions simultaneously, this architecture is what makes genuinely comprehensive reporting possible without the manual aggregation overhead that currently consumes analyst time. A quarterly business review that previously required three people two days to compile can be orchestrated by a coordinating agent who delegates simultaneously to domain-specific sub-agents.
  • Platform integration agents excel at orchestrating actions across disparate connected systems. For Monday RevOps AI workflow environments where leads arrive from web forms, flow through qualification boards, trigger CRM updates, prompt outreach sequences, and require handoff coordination between marketing and sales, platform integration agents handle the cross-system orchestration that is otherwise managed through a combination of Zapier recipes, manual handoffs, and hope.

The pattern selection is not permanent. Most mature Monday.com implementation environments use different patterns for different workflow categories simultaneously: sequential agents for operational processes, iterative agents for analytical work, and distributed systems for executive reporting.

What AI Agents Actually Do Inside Monday.com: Team by Team


The theoretical architecture matters less than what it enables in practice. Here is what AI agents look like when they are properly configured across the team functions that most organizations run on monday.com.

1. For PMO Teams

A PMO managing a portfolio of fifteen concurrent projects used to spend its Monday mornings doing something that should not require a Monday morning: aggregating status updates from fifteen different boards, identifying which projects were behind, calculating overall portfolio health, and preparing something coherent for executive review. With a properly configured AI agent in a Monday.com PMO Solutions environment, that workflow changes character entirely.

The agent runs autonomously before the Monday meeting. It queries every project board, identifies tasks that have transitioned to overdue status since the last review, cross-references those against milestone dependencies to flag which delays have downstream consequences, calculates sprint velocity against planned delivery timelines, and produces a structured portfolio summary with risk ratings. By the time the PMO director opens their laptop, the meeting preparation is done, and the meeting itself becomes a decision-making session rather than a status update session.

The same architecture applies to resource management. Rather than a manual weekly exercise of checking capacity across teams, an AI agent operating on structured Monday.com work management boards continuously monitors workload distribution and flags imbalances before they become delivery risks.

2. For CRM and Revenue Teams

Monday.com CRM with AI agents changes the fundamental economics of sales administration. The most consistent complaint from revenue teams is not that they do not know what to do; it is that so much of their time is absorbed by the administrative work surrounding what they need to do. McKinsey estimates that generative AI could automate activities consuming up to 60-70% of employee time, particularly across administrative and operational workflows, which is why AI-enabled CRM environments are becoming a major efficiency priority for revenue teams.

Logging call notes, updating deal stages, researching account history before a follow-up call, drafting outreach emails, and routing qualified leads to the right rep are all tasks that an AI agent can handle faster, more consistently, and without the variability introduced by a team member who is also managing fifteen other priorities.

In practice, this looks like a rep completing a discovery call, their call transcript is automatically processed, the AI agent extracts key information, updates the deal record with next steps, drafts a follow-up email in the rep’s voice for review, and creates a task for the follow-up, all before the rep has finished their post-call notes. The Monday AI workflows 2026 capability that makes this possible is not speculative. It is running in production for organizations that configured their CRM boards with the structured data fields that give the AI agent what it needs to act reliably, typically under the guidance of certified Monday.com experts who understand exactly which fields, which status taxonomies, and which automation triggers enable the AI layer to perform at its best.

For Monday RevOps AI workflow environments, the agent layer operates at the pipeline level rather than the deal level. Monitoring pipeline velocity, flagging deals that have gone dark, identifying accounts showing buying signals across multiple touchpoints, and coordinating the handoff between marketing-qualified and sales-qualified pipeline stages, these are the RevOps functions that AI agents handle autonomously, freeing the RevOps team to focus on strategy rather than triage.

3. For Cross-Functional Work Management

The insight that the monday.com reference material returns to repeatedly, and that Certified Monday.com Experts have validated through implementation experience, is that AI agents perform best when they have access to cross-functional context rather than departmental silos.

An agent that can only see the product board sees sprint velocity. An agent who can see the product board, the sales pipeline, the customer success board, and the resource management board sees that three enterprise deals in the final stages are dependent on a feature that the product team just moved from Q3 to Q4 and that this dependency has not been surfaced to anyone. That is the difference between departmental automation and organizational intelligence.

AI project management Monday in a mature implementation means agents that operate across this connected data model, not running independently within each team’s boards, but coordinating across them to surface the cross-functional risks and dependencies that siloed tools structurally cannot see.

The Data Foundation That Makes Everything Work

None of this functions without the data foundation underneath it. This is the insight that separates implementations built by Certified Monday.com Experts from implementations built by competent users who are not thinking architecturally.

Structured data is not a technical nicety. It is the prerequisite for reliable agent behavior. When every board item has a clear owner, an unambiguous status from a defined taxonomy, a timeline marker, a priority designation, and the right dependency connections, agents operate with precision. They do not infer. They know.

When boards are built organically over time, with status labels that mean different things in different contexts, ownership fields left blank for items that “everyone” is responsible for, and naming conventions that reflect whoever created the board rather than an organizational standard, agents cannot be reliable. The observation layer sees an inconsistency and produces inconsistent outputs.

This is why Monday.com Implementation done well in 2026 looks different from implementation done two years ago. The question is no longer just “how do we configure boards to be usable for human teams?” It is “how do we configure the data architecture so that AI agents can operate on it reliably?” The answers to both questions are complementary; clean, well-structured boards are better for humans and necessary for agents. Governance, Trust, and the Human Oversight Layer

Deploying AI agents in business-critical workflows without governance controls does not accelerate transformation. It produces the kind of AI incident that results in a company-wide rollback and a six-month pause on anything AI-related.

Governance built at the architectural level (not bolted on afterwards) is what allows organizations to expand agent deployment confidently across departments. Gartner predicts that by 2027, 40% of enterprise AI agent projects will be scaled back or abandoned because of governance, security, and operational control failures, making governance architecture one of the most critical components of long-term AI success.

Role-based access controls define precisely what each agent can observe, what it can modify, and what it must escalate for human approval before executing. Audit logging captures every agent action with a timestamp and decision rationale, enabling both compliance verification and performance review. Approval workflow integration creates deliberate pause points where agents stop and request human authorization before taking consequential actions, budget modifications, external communications, and contract-related updates.

Only 11 percent of organizations have implemented governance frameworks for AI agents, according to Gartner research, despite rapid adoption growth. The gap between adoption and governance is where most AI agent programs eventually stall, not because the technology fails, but because the trust fails. Organizations that embed governance from the first day of their Monday.com implementation build trust and expand agent scope systematically. Organizations that add governance after the fact find themselves retrofitting controls into a deployment that was not designed to accommodate them. Frequently Asked Questions

1. Why do most Monday.com AI agent implementations underperform?

Because they’re added on top of messy systems. Teams often treat AI like an upgrade instead of a foundation-level change. If your boards, data fields, and workflows aren’t structured properly, the agent doesn’t have enough clarity to make good decisions; it just produces average output faster.

2. Do I need a certified monday.com expert to implement AI agents?

Not always, but it makes a significant difference. Experts think in terms of architecture, not just setup. They design your boards, data structure, and workflows in a way that actually enables AI to perform reliably, instead of just “turning features on.”

3. What’s the biggest mistake teams make when setting up AI in monday.com?

Jumping straight into automation and agents without fixing their data structure first. Missing ownership, inconsistent statuses, and unclear priorities confuse the AI layer. Clean, structured data is what turns AI from a gimmick into something genuinely useful.

4. Can AI agents replace manual work across teams like PMO or sales?

They don’t replace teams, but they remove a huge chunk of repetitive work. Things like status reporting, data updates, follow-ups, and coordination can be handled automatically, which frees teams up to focus on decisions, strategy, and execution.

5. How do I know if my monday.com setup is ready for AI agents?

A simple test: if your workflows are consistent, your data fields are complete, and your boards reflect how your business actually operates, you’re on the right track. If not, it’s worth fixing the foundation first, because that’s what determines whether AI agents actually deliver value or just create noise.
